While enforcement varies by region and over time, the immediate effect has been the expected and desired one of clearing the streets (at least temporarily) and displacing people/women in prostitution to remote areas. Indoors prostitution has increased, and quality of life in general has deteriorated. Unprotected sex has increased due to reduced ability to negotiate. Stigmatization and vulnerability have increased, as has a greater reliance on social services. As noted in other countries, as soon as police activity is reduced, older prostitution patterns reappear. On 7 April 2011, the
Italian Constitutional Court with the Sentence n. 115/2011 decided that this kind of Mayors' Ordinances must have time and space limits and urgent conditions to be issued. So, the simple exercise of street prostitution could be no more persecuted by this kind of local bills.

In 2008, it was estimated that 65% of people in prostitution are on the streets and 35% in private residences or clubs. 20% were stated to be minors and 10% to have been forced into prostitution by criminal gangs. The bill is framed as an amendment to the Legge Merlin of 20 February 1958, No 75 by providing for penalties for the act of prostitution, solicitation, or availing oneself of sexual services in a place open to the public (Art. 1). Article 2 amends article 600 bis of the penal code to provide

A 1997/1998 study of 142 street prostitutes from Rome (102 women, 40 transsexual women) showed that most respondents (95%) reported always using condoms with clients. 8% of the women and 2% of the transsexual women reported injectable drug use. 38% of the women with a stable partner used

A 2008 report stated that were some 100,000 prostitutes in Italy. In 2007 it was stated that the total number of people in prostitution was 70,000. The Italian Statistics Institute stated the number of street people in prostitution in 1998 was 50,000.

A 2010 court decision created a new precedent that clients who did not pay the person in prostitution would be considered guilty of rape. This was considered a major breakthrough for prostitutes' rights.
